How Resident-Owned Communities Can Create Mass Affordable Homeownership

NonProfit Quarterly

An underappreciated tool for closing this gap—potentially benefitting millions of US households—involves resident-owned manufactured housing communities. A Freddie Mac Multifamily survey conducted in 2019 estimated 45,000 manufactured housing communities operating across the United States. There is another option—a cooperative option.

Youth Unemployment in the Developing World Is a Jobs Problem

Stanford Social Innovation Review

Other examples abound: Mastercard Foundation, which aims to address youth unemployment in Africa by creating 30 million jobs, identifies “improving the quality of education and vocational training” and “leveraging technology to connect employers and job seekers” as its first two strategies to enable job creation.
